๐ฏ What is a Gradient in CSS?
A gradient is a visual effect where one color gradually transitions into another. CSS provides linear-gradient and radial-gradient functions to create these effects. In this tutorial, weโll use a linear gradient with three different colors to make our background dynamic and colorful.

๐งฑ HTML + CSS 3-Color Gradient Animation โ Full Source Code
Here is the complete code weโll build in this tutorial. You can copy and paste it into your code editor to see it in action.
๐ index.html
<!DOCTYPE html>
<html lang="en">
<head>
<meta charset="UTF-8">
<meta name="viewport" content="width=device-width, initial-scale=1.0">
<title>Animated 3-Color Gradient</title>
<link rel="stylesheet" href="style.css">
</head>
<body class="top">
<header>
<div class="logo">
<span>nebula</span>
</div>
<nav class="links">
<a href="#">Home</a>
<a href="#">About</a>
<a href="#">Contact</a>
</nav>
</header>
<section class="hero">
<p>Discipline Will Take You</p>
<p>Places Motivation Can't</p>
<p class="lines">Lorem ipsum dolor sit amet, consectetur adipisicing elit. Cumque ad ratione, quas mollitia doloribus explicabo?</p>
</section>
</body>
</html>
๐จ style.css
@import url('https://fonts.googleapis.com/css2?family=Poppins:wght@500&display=swap');
body {
max-width: 900px;
margin: 0 auto;
padding: 0;
background-color: #f3f3f3;
font-family: 'Poppins', sans-serif;
}
.top {
background: linear-gradient(56deg, #062c8f, #ff6a8e, #c3c3c3 );
background-size: 200% 340%;
animation: gradient-animation 27s ease infinite;
}
@keyframes gradient-animation {
0% {
background-position: 0% 50%;
}
50% {
background-position: 100% 50%;
}
100% {
background-position: 0% 50%;
}
}
header {
display: flex;
align-items: center;
justify-content: space-between;
margin: 1rem 0rem;
padding: 1rem 1rem;
}
.logo span {
color: #c4ff22;
font-size: 3rem;
}
.links {
display: flex;
align-items: center;
justify-content: center;
margin-right: 4.5rem;
}
.links a {
color: #c4ff22;
text-decoration: none;
font-size: 1.5rem;
margin: 0 1rem;
}
p {
display: flex;
align-items: center;
justify-content: center;
text-align: center;
color: #000000;
font-size: 3rem;
margin-top: 2rem;
font-weight: 700;
margin: 0;
}
.lines {
display: flex;
margin: 1rem auto;
width: 60%;
text-align: center;
font-size: 1rem;
}

3. Gradient Background Setup
.top {
background: linear-gradient(56deg, #062c8f, #ff6a8e, #c3c3c3 );
background-size: 200% 340%;
animation: gradient-animation 27s ease infinite;
}
The gradient moves at a 56-degree angle.
It uses three colors: deep blue (
#062c8f), soft pink (#ff6a8e), and light gray (#c3c3c3).The
background-sizeis much larger than the element size to allow for smooth transitions.The animation
gradient-animationloops infinitely over 27 seconds.
4. CSS Keyframes Animation
@keyframes gradient-animation {
0% {
background-position: 0% 50%;
}
50% {
background-position: 100% 50%;
}
100% {
background-position: 0% 50%;
}
}
This keyframe animation changes the background position to create a smooth left-to-right gradient transition and then resets.

๐ ๏ธ Customize It Your Way
Want to make it your own? Here are a few customization ideas:
Change the colors to match your brand palette
Adjust the animation duration for faster or slower transitions
Use a radial-gradient for circular patterns
Add overlay content like buttons or CTAs
